Care Plan Tips from Sheri

I attended the CPNEworkshop.com in Atlanta the end of January. I had not done a real care plan - ever. I had just learned about NANDA labels while preparing for the Nursing theory exams in August. Sheri and Gregg had wonderful tips and made it understandable.

  • When selecting your careplan remember The basic physiological needs, Maslow Hiearchy is good.
    • ABCs  = Airway, Breathing, Circulation, Safety (pain is at the top also)
  • You have to have one actual problem (or they would not be in the hospital). The second one can be either an actual or risk for problem.
  • You must have a goal the begins with "the patient" and ends with during my PCS (to make it measurable)
